The worlds oceans have had their hottest ever recorded temperature as they soak up warmth from climate change. Scientists say the average Surface Temperature reached 20. 96 celsius this week, surpassing the previous high set in 2016. The government are set out plans to expand the use of the private sector to tackle the nhs backlog in england. 30 new Community Diagnostic Centres are being set up, eight of which will be run privately. The sector already carries out hundreds of thousands of treatments for the Health Service each year, but it says it has the capacity to do around 30 more. Hello. We start with breaking news imran khan, pakistan s former Prime Minister, has been arrested, after being sentenced to three years in prison. His team say they will file an appeal against the ruling. Thejudge found him guilty of failing to declare money he had earned from selling state gifts. As the decision was announced in islamabad a crowd, including some prosecuting lawyers, began chanting, Imran Khan Is A Thief outside court. Multiple cases have been filed against mr khan in the last 16 months. In may, he was detained for not appearing at court as requested but was subsequently released after the arrest was declared illegal. Since then his party has been under intense pressure from the authorities with many senior officials leaving and thousands of supporters arrested, accused of being involved in the protests that followed imran khans arrest.
